Application of Grey Relational Theory in Moving Object Detection from Video Sequences

  • Based on the similarity between the present image and background images,a method based on grey relational theory is proposed to detect the moving objects from video sequences.The video sequences are captured by the fixed cameras under various illumination conditions of indoor and outdoor scenes.By appropriately choosing the comparative sequences,the grey relational degree between them and the present frame is computed and moving targets are viably detected.The proposed method is not exigent to the background image,is insensitive to noise and to some extent is also robust to occlusion.
